About BlueHeart Energy BlueHeart Energy was founded in 2016 as a deep-tech company that has developed a new sustainable thermoacoustics technology to radically improve the performance of heat pumps, enabling them to evolve from being the best solution in the market to becoming the perfect solution. Our technology is a disruptive approach to generate heat and cold, with potential to revolutionize the whole industry. With our so called 'BlueHeart' engine, we turn heat pumps into affordable, silent and flexible devices, capable of working with wide temperature ranges suitable for both new and existing houses. Importantly, BlueHeart doesn’t require any refrigerants and doesn’t generate any CO2 emissions. The BlueHeart engine is also used for other (industrial) application to heat or cool. About the Role As Senior System Engineer (Thermoacoustic Heat Pump Systems) , you will support the development and integration of BlueHeart Energy's thermoacoustic heat pump technology by translating customer and product requirements into clear system specifications and engineering solutions. You will ensure that system requirements, interfaces, and performance targets are consistently implemented across the product and over the product lifecycle. You will collaborate closely with the Head of Development (who is also our system architect), and the Product and Component Owners to support the development of a reliable, efficient, and compliant heat pump system. In this role, you will drive the requirements management, verification and validation activities, configuration management and product baselining, support system integration (including interface definition and management), participate in technical trade-off analyses, and assist in identifying and mitigating technical risks, helping to ensure that subsystem developments align with overall system objectives. You promote systems thinking throughout the organization by challenging Product and Component Owners in system thinking, and you manage the evidence that the designed system satisfies stakeholder requirements throughout the product lifecycle.
